Princeton, NJ, Febraury 25, 2010 -- Donald J. Hofmann of West Windsor, New Jerse
y, has been named chairman of the Board of Trustees of Princeton HealthCare Syst
em (http://www.princetonhcs.org), PHCS announced today.
Hofmann, who previously served as the board s vice chairman and treasurer, starts
his leadership tenure at an historic time for PHCS, with his three-year term set
to include the opening of the new University Medical Center of Princeton at Pla
insboro, the system s replacement hospital for University Medical Center of Prince
ton.
In a symbolic coincidence, Hofmann also happens to be the first non-Princeton re
sident to lead the board in the institution s 91-year history.
This area has been my home for many years, and the chance to continue serving the
local communities of our region is a great honor, said Hofmann. At a time when ma
ny hospitals are struggling, Princeton HealthCare System looks to the future wit
h confidence, guided by the vision laid out by our board and management team to
build one of the finest regional medical centers in the United States. I look fo
rward to working with system President and CEO Barry Rabner, our medical staff l
eadership and the entire PHCS healthcare team at this exciting time in our histo
ry.
A graduate of Harvard Business School, Hofmann is a managing partner of Crystal
Ridge Partners, a Princeton-based private equity firm he co-founded in 2005. Pri
or to that, Hofmann was a senior partner of JP Morgan Partners and its predecess
ors, involved in all aspects of the management of the firm.
He has served on the PHCS board since 2002 and succeeds Edward Matthews as the b
oard s chairman.
Hofmann s other community involvement includes membership on the board of HomeFron
t, a non-profit group based in Lawrenceville that works with families to break t
he cycle of poverty. He is also a former trustee of Princeton Day School.
He and his wife, Joyce Hofmann, have two sons.
About Princeton HealthCare System
Princeton HealthCare System is a nonprofit organization that includes University
Medical Center at Princeton, Princeton House Behavioral Health, Princeton Rehab
ilitation Services, Merwick Care Center, Princeton HomeCare Services and Univers
ity Medical Center at Princeton Surgical Center. PHCS is a joint venture partner
in Princeton Fitness & Wellness Center and Princeton Endoscopy Center. Universi
ty Medical Center at Princeton is an acute care, teaching community hospital and
a University Hospital Affiliate of UMDNJ-Robert Wood Johnson Medical School. It
is a Clinical Research Affiliate of The Cancer Institute of New Jersey, the onl
y facility in the state designated as a Comprehensive Cancer Center by the Natio
nal Cancer Institute. Princeton HealthCare System also operates several addition
al affiliates including Princeton HealthCare System Occupational Medicine Servic
es, Princeton HealthCare System Medical Equipment, Princeton HealthCare Manageme
nt Services, and Princeton Medical Properties. The system has 477 beds, over 2,8
00 employees, 45 residents and fellows from the UMDNJ- Robert Wood Johnson Resid
ency Training Programs, and an active medical staff of 906 physicians and dentis
ts.
